A structural ironworker is a skilled tradesperson who specializes in the construction and installation of steel frameworks, also known as structural iron or steel. They play a crucial role in the construction industry by erecting the skeletal structures of buildings, bridges, and other large structures. Their job involves reading blueprints, measuring and cutting steel beams, columns, and plates, and then connecting them using various techniques such as welding or bolting. They work at great heights, often using cranes or other lifting equipment to position heavy steel components. Safety is of utmost importance in this occupation, as ironworkers must wear protective gear and follow strict safety protocols.

Structural Iron Worker salary in Canada
Average Yearly Salary of Structural Iron Worker in Canada is approximately 47,676 CAD (47,835 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. The value indicated is an average amount based on records we have in database. Real values may vary. The data is for orientational purposes.
